Takashige, I just tried it out the SDF, i dots and a line using 1.20... I just noticed you are using the LayerDefinition-1.0.0.xsd namespace. There is a newer version under C:\Program Files\MapGuideOpenSource\Server\Schema\LayerDefinition-1.1.0.xsd which adds CompositeTypeStyle, looks like that
